Americus Turf Conditions

Americus sits in southwest Georgia's sandy clay region, which drains well but compacts easily—exactly the kind of soil that suffers most when dogs dig and run. Natural grass struggles here because the soil doesn't hold nutrients the way it does in other parts of the state, and pet urine breaks down what little turf you manage to establish. Our mild climate is actually perfect for artificial turf; you don't get the extreme temperature swings that cause material stress in hotter or colder zones. Sun exposure varies significantly depending on neighborhood—downtown properties and those near the Lee Street District often have mature trees that create dappled shade, while yards closer to the Georgia Southwestern campus or in newer developments get full afternoon sun. That matters for material selection and cooling properties. Most Americus yards range from quarter-acre to half-acre residential lots, which means installation is straightforward without massive site prep. The sandy base you already have is honestly ideal; we don't need extensive grading or fill work like you'd see in clay-heavy counties. One local consideration: Sumter County doesn't have restrictive HOA landscape codes in most neighborhoods, so you have flexibility, but it's always smart to check your deed if you're in a planned community.

How does pet turf handle urine in sandy clay soil like ours?

This is actually where artificial turf shines in Americus. Sand and clay don't absorb urine evenly—you get concentrated burn spots and odor buildup. Pet turf drains urine straight through the backing into a proper base layer, so it never sits in the material. No discoloration, no ammonia smell lingering in your yard. You just rinse it occasionally and you're done.

Will I need special maintenance because of Americus's climate and soil type?

Maintenance is minimal and actually easier than natural grass in our region. You'll rinse the turf occasionally to clear debris, brush it occasionally to keep fibers upright, and that's it. No fertilizer, no pesticides, no watering—all things that become expensive chores in sandy clay soil. Your pets are safer, and your time is your own.
